Liuwomijuzhi, which is a new type of insecticide of non-ester oxime aether pyrethroids, has been researched and developed by Hunan Branch of National Southern Pesticide Research and Development Ceter, Hunan Research Institute of Chemical Industry in recent years .Now it has been registered and there is no English name. The pure sample is achromous solids. Its melting point is 27.3-27.1#.The compound is not soluble in water, but it is easily soluble in a majority of organic solvent. Liuwomijuzhi is not only high efficient, quick and broad spectrum, but also low toxic to mammal and safe to plant. Because this compound is new, there is no its studies on aspect of environmental behaviour in the world. This paper studied primely adsorption course and mechanism of Liuwomijuzhi on five soils whose physical and chemical characteristics are different. The major experiment contents and results are as follows:1 This article studied the adsorption course of Liuwomijuzhi on five soils who possess different physical and chemical characteristics , including optimum ratio of water/soil, the time of reaching adsorption equilibrium, the influence of soil pH on adsorption and the isotherm. The result shows that the adsorption strength of Liuwomijuzhi on soils is big (the value of kf is 102.81-187.20 ), the time of reaching equilibrium is short and adsorption is negatively related to soil pH. The adsorption benefit from the reduce of pH and the changes are apparent at pH 4 to 6.2 The adsorption course of Liuwomijuzhi on Clay and Humic acid was researched primely. Adsorption data on Ca-clay and humic acids could fit Freundlich-type equation and the value of kf is 2074.1 and 539.41 respectively. The adsorption on Ca-clay is stronger than on humic acids. Because of interacting Ca-clay with humic acids, adsorption of Liuwomijuzhi on the complex of clay with humic acids was less than clay and humic acids alone. But the interaction is reverse and the active center will be released respectively again after a period of time.3 The interaction mechanisms between Liuwomijuzhi to Ca-clay with humic acids were discussed by means of Fourier transform infrared spectra in this experiment. The results of IR showed that the formation of hydrogen bonds may be the main interaction mechanism.
